The evolution of Greek football rivalries is inextricably linked to the establishment and growth of its professional leagues. While informal contests have always existed, the formalization of the Alpha Ethniki (now Super League) in 1959 marked a crucial turning point. This era saw the rise of the traditional Athenian giants – Olympiacos, Panathinaikos, and AEK – whose dominance sha the national narrative for decades. However, the late 20th and early 21st centuries witnessed a decentralization of power. The emergence of clubs from outside the capital, such as PAOK Thessaloniki and, more recently, Asteras Tripolis, began to challenge this hegemony. This shift wasn't instantaneous; it was a gradual process fueled by strategic investment, astute management, and the cultivation of passionate local support. The '90s and early 2000s, for instance, saw a gradual increase in the competitiveness of the league, with more teams capable of challenging the established order. This period also saw the introduction of more modern training facilities and a greater focus on youth development, laying the foundation for clubs like Asteras Tripolis to consistently compete at the highest level. The impact of these developments on fan culture is profound, fostering a sense of regional pride and creating new, compelling narratives that extend beyond the historical Athens-Thessaloniki axis.
